What I'd like to see is a Population Demographic page that lists the numberS of Bannies by age so the player can know how many are at the threshold of advancing into the next Child/Student/Adult category. At points when those population shifts (i.e. dreaded Die-offs and the eventual return to growth) are about to happen, I want this Demographic break-down so much that I resort to clicking from house-to-house looking for students on the cusp of graduating.
